    Movie force powers:

    Grip
    TK
    Lightning
    Jump
    Float (in a manner)
    Superhuman reflexes
    Seeing the future
    Absorb
    Strike/Destroy Droid
    Mind Trick

    EU-only:

    Speed*
    Heal (in various forms)
    Protection*
    Rage*
    Battle Meditation*
    Drain Life
    Memory Erasal*

    * = implied as possible (or maybe used) in movies

    I know there are ones I left out, but most are specialized versions of those.

    That'd fall under the "mindtrick" category for me, but it could be its own.

    If you think about it, most/all of those fall into three categories:

    Chanelling Force Energy (through your own body) (Lightning Rage, Heal, Protect, Absorb, Reflexes, etc.)

    Telekinesis (Grip, Push, Pull, Jump, Speed, Float)

    Alter Mind/Mindtrick (What Anakin does to the reek, Mindtricks, Memory Erasal, causing the sound in DS1, etc.)
